The Red Baron, directed by Nikolai Müllerschön, immerses you in the gritty atmosphere of World War I aerial combat. It captures the essence of heroism and the tragic reality behind the glamor of dogfights. The film does a decent job balancing action with the psychological struggles of Richthofen, who evolves from a celebrated pilot into a more complex character grappling with the morality of war. The practical effects are commendable, bringing an authentic feel to the aerial sequences. Performances are solid, especially from Matthias Schweighöfer as Richthofen, who brings depth to the role. It’s not just a war film; it’s a meditation on honor and the cost of glory, all wrapped in an engaging narrative that keeps you invested throughout.
